Class-specific antibody in human dermatophytosis reactive with Trichophyton rubrum derived antigen
Abstract
Dermatophyte infections induce a humoral immune response and an enzyme linked immunosorbent assay was used to detect specific antibody classes against antigen derived from Trichophyton rubrum. Sera from 19 acute patients, 18 chronic patients, and 27 normal controls were evaluated. Mean IgG titers against dermatophyte antigen were significantly higher in all patients than in controls. Mean IgM levels were significantly higher in acute patients than in controls. No significant difference was detected in IgE titers between the patients and controls. These results do not reveal whether the humoral immune response has a role in the progression of the infection.
